Driveway Slab Lifting in Miami Dade County, FL
Driveway slab lifting is a service that addresses uneven or sunken concrete slabs in residential driveways. This process involves carefully raising and leveling the existing concrete to restore a smooth, safe surface. It is commonly requested for projects where cracks, cracks, or unevenness have developed over time due to soil movement, erosion, or freeze-thaw cycles. Homeowners typically seek this service to improve curb appeal, prevent further damage, and ensure a safe, level surface for vehicles and foot traffic.
Property owners considering driveway slab lifting should understand the current condition of the concrete and the underlying soil stability. It’s important to evaluate whether the existing slab can be effectively restored or if replacement might be necessary. Additionally, understanding the extent of the unevenness and any underlying causes can help determine the most appropriate repair approach. Contacting a professional can provide guidance on whether slab lifting is suitable for a specific driveway and what to expect from the process.
